ORDER
The writ petition is filed to direct the respondents to consider and dispose of the petitioner's representation dated 01.08.2024 within a time frame to be fixed by this Court.
2. It is the case of the petitioner that he had joined the respondent-Mill as a Shift Supervisor on temporary basis on 03.10.1996. He has rendered 28 years of blemishless service in the respondent spinning Mills. During the year 2007, the post of Assistant Spinning Master (Quality Control) and (Maintenance) became vacant due to the resignation of one S.Balaji and K.Valli Nayagam. The post of Factory Manager has also been vacant since 2007. He would further submit that, as per Subsidiary Regulation 17(a), the post of Shift Supervisor is the feeder post to the post of Assistant Spinning Master. An employee who has completed five 2/6
years of service as a Shift Supervisor is eligible for promotion to the post of Assistant Spinning Master. However, the respondentManagement decided to fill up the said posts on contract basis without considering the requests of the in-service employees. Subsequently, one A.Charles Vijay was appointed on contract basis from June 2008 and the said arrangement continued on a yearly basis till 2012. His services were regularised by the respondent by order dated 01.08.2012 in violation of the applicable Rules. Neither a Recruitment Committee was appointed nor a Board Resolution passed for appointing him as a regular employee.
3. According to the petitioner, the respondent-Management is filling up the posts on contract basis without considering eligible in-service candidates and has violated the rule of reservation. In this regard, he had made a representation dated 01.08.2024 to the Chairman-cum-District Collector and the Managing Director of the respondent Mill. However, his request has not been considered so 3/6
far. Hence, the petitioner is before this Court.
4. Heard the learned counsels on either side and perused the materials available on record.
5. Considering the facts and circumstances of the case, particularly the fact that posts are being filled upon contract basis ignoring in house candidates a mandamus is issued to the respondents to consider the representation of the petitioner dated 01.08.2024, and pass orders on merits and in accordance with law within a period of two months from the date of receipt of a copy of this order. Accordingly, this Writ Petition is disposed of No costs. 11.08.2025 srn To The District Collector, Karaikal 4/6
